在CSS 中,overflow-y: auto和overflow-x: visible的组合可能会导致一些意外的行为,因为overflow属性的行为在同时设置x和y时有一些特殊规则。以下是详细解释和解决方案: 1. 默认行为 当同时设置overflow-x和overflow-y时: 如果其中一个设置为visible,而另一个设置为auto、scroll或
overflow-y属性用于控制垂直方向上的溢出内容的显示方式,取值与overflow-x相同。 要修复工具提示的显示问题,可以根据实际情况设置overflow-x和overflow-y属性。如果工具提示的内容在水平方向上溢出,可以将overflow-x设置为scroll或auto,以显示水平滚动条。如果工具提示的内容在垂直方向上溢出,可以将overflow-y设置为sc...
其中,overflow-x属性用来定义内容超出元素“宽度”时应该如何处理,而overflow-y属性用来定义内容超出元素“高度”时应该如何处理。 语法: overflow-x: 取值;overflow-y: 取值; 说明: overflow-x和overflow-y这两个属性都有4种取值,如下表所示。 overflow-x 属性取值 overflow-y属性取值 overflow-x和overflow-y这两...
'overflow' 是 CSS 2.1 规范中的特性,而 'overflow-x' 和 'overflow-y' 则是 CSS basic box model 草案中新加入的特性。 'overflow' 特性指定当一个块级元素的内容溢出了元素的框(它作为内容的包含块)时,是否剪切; 'overflow-x' 决定了对左右边(水平方向)的剪切,而 'overflow-y' 决定了对上下边(垂直...
大家可以发现,上网站上查询之后会得到overflow-x和overflow-y的一大堆属性值,但很多网站并没有详细说明各属性值的效果,我们今天细说一下。 各属性值如下: visible:默认值,不裁剪内容,可能会显示在内容框之外 hidden:裁剪内容 - 不提供滚动机制 scroll:裁剪内容 - 提供滚动机制 ...
于是用到了overflow-y 和 overflow-x 这个css属性 原来以为css中直接设置就ok { overflow-y:scroll; overflow-x: visible; } 但是实际情况是并不好用 会出现两边都是scroll的情况上网上查了一下解决方案,很多都说试着将overflow-x和overflow-y放在不同的DOM元素上。但是会因为实际使用情况和逻辑上的复杂程度而...
容器div的width和height都比xxx.jpg图片小 css中设定 div { overflow-y: hidden; overflow-x: visible; } 结果是图片在y方向被裁减,在x方向出现滚动条,auto的效果. 但按照overflow定义,visible应该是会显示在容器外。 overflow也有优先级么?css 有用关注2收藏2 回复 阅读8.1k 2 个回答 ...
至於解決方案這種情況可以考慮 nested div。裏面的 overflow-y: hidden;外面的 overflow-x: visible;
overflow-x 和 overflow-yCreated: November-22, 2018 这两个属性的工作方式与 overflow 属性类似,并且接受相同的值。overflow-x 参数仅适用于 x 或左右轴。overflow-y 在y 轴或从上到下轴上工作。 HTML If this div is too small to display its contents, the content to the left and right will be ...
‘overflow-x’ 和‘overflow-y’ 的计算值与其指定值相同,除了某些与 ‘visible’ 的组合是不可能的:如果一个被指定为 ‘visible’ 而另一个被指定为 ‘scroll’或“自动”,然后“可见”设置为“自动”。如果’overflow-y’相同,’overflow’的计算值等于’overflow-x’的计算值;否则它是“overflow-x”和“ov...